Hubbard Feeds Inc. is recalling Tradition Game Bird Starter for Pheasant, Quail, and Chukar, which is packaged in 50 lb. bags. This recall was initiated because the product has the potential to be contaminated with Salmonella, a pathogen that can cause serious and sometimes fatal infections. The affected feed was delivered to two specific locations in Central City and Caneyville, Kentucky. Consumers should not use this feed and should return it to the place of purchase for a full refund.
Salmonella can cause severe infections in young children, the elderly, and individuals with weakened immune systems. Additionally, pets or livestock consuming contaminated feed can become sick or act as carriers, potentially spreading the bacteria to humans through contact.
